No:298/24, Press release on the meeting between Minister of Foreign Affairs Jeyhun Bayramov and Director General of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the State of Israel, Yaakov Blitshtein

24 July 2024 17:29

On 24 July 2024, a meeting was held between the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Azerbaijan, Jeyhun Bayramov, and the Director General of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the State of Israel, Yaakov Blitshtein.

 

During the meeting, various aspects of bilateral and multilateral relations were discussed, including the current state and prospects of cooperation between the two countries in the fields of economy, security, high technologies, education, tourism, energy, transport, and others, as well as the situation in Gaza.

 

Minister Jeyhun Bayramov informed the other side about the current situation in the region in the post-conflict period and the Azerbaijan-Armenia normalization process.

 

It was noted that within the framework of our country’s presidency of the Conference of the Parties to the United Nations Framework Convention on Climate Change (COP29), additional opportunities have emerged for cooperation between the two countries.

 

During the meeting, an exchange of views also took place on other international and regional issues of mutual interest.
